From Football and Fine Jewelry to Gowns and Glamour

Started 1329841935.69 in Jewelry Talk, Judith Ripka | Last reply 1330608374.06 by Me2Me

Thank you to my fans who tuned into my last shows, especially those who stayed with me throughout the Super Bowl and star-studded halftime show.  You made it a wonderful weekend. 

So, as we all gear up for another big media event, the Oscars, I have created a special Red Carpet ring, J265032, and pair of earrings, J265033, for QVC to launch in honor of this iconic award show.  As Hollywood’s A-list actresses get dressed up in their most glamorous gowns, I thought it would perfect for me to design a collection which celebrate “very classic, Hollywood style.”  And, right now, it seems more appropriate than ever, because New York Fashion Week runways paid homage to the glamour and sultry style of old Hollywood with feminine looks of classic elegance, hair with smooth waves and clean make-up juxtaposed with deep red lips. 

Both the ring, J265032, and the earrings, J265033, boast custom faceted crystal stones, which look and feel like canary diamonds.  The many custom facets give these pieces even greater brilliance, so that their sparkle will surely turn heads.  What I love most about the canary hue is that it gives the perfect pop of color while staying neutral, so that these pieces will coordinate with everything in your wardrobe.  I have also designed them using more modern silhouettes, so that the pieces are as wearable every day as they are on the “red carpet.”  These pieces are what I call bold, beautiful basics, conveying a sense of strength and beauty, much like all of you, the women who wear my jewelry. 

I hope you will tune in to see Lisa Robertson debut these 2 very special new pieces during QVC’s Red Carpet show on February 24 from 9pm-Midnight.  And, I also look forward to going back to the Q in late March with a new TSV and over 10-hours of airtime!
